Determine the population and the sample.Every 75th computer coming off an assembly line is checked for defects.

A. Population: all computers coming off the assembly line; Sample: every 75th computer
B. Population: all computers coming off the assembly line; Sample: 75 computers
C. Population: 75 computers; Sample: one computer
D. Population: every 75th computer coming off the assembly line; Sample: 75 computers


Answer: A
